Genetic Testing Services: Accelerated Backcrossing / Speed Congenics

MAX-BAXsm (Marker-Assisted Accelerated Backcrossing) is a speed congenics program that facilitates the rapid production of congenic strains of knockout or transgenic rodents, as well as other species. This pioneering process selects individuals with preferred genetic backgrounds and reduces the number of generations needed to produce a congenic research model.

Backcrossing guided by our microsatellite analysis data achieves 99.9% congenicity in approximately five generations, a savings of 1.5 years of breeding time (five generations) over random backcrossing. We offer panels for a variety of the most popular animal models.
